I'm raising money for a cause I care about, but I need your help to reach my goal! Please become a supporter to follow my progress and share with your friends.
Subscribe to follow campaign updates!
In the era of digital banking, mobile wallets, and instant payments, financial transactions have become faster, easier, and more convenient than ever before. Yet, this convenience comes with a rising threat, cyberattacks, data breaches, and security vulnerabilities targeting financial systems. For banks, fintech companies, and digital payment platforms, ensuring the security of financial transactions is not optional; it’s a fundamental business imperative.
This is where security testing plays a vital role. It acts as a shield that identifies potential vulnerabilities, prevents unauthorized access, and ensures that every digital transaction is executed in a safe and compliant environment.
Let’s explore how security testing safeguards financial transactions and why it must be a top priority for any financial institution or fintech innovator.
Why Security Testing Matters in Finance
Financial applications handle highly sensitive data ,from user credentials and credit card details to transaction histories and investment portfolios. Even a minor flaw in the system can lead to severe financial losses, reputational damage, and legal implications.
A recent rise in digital payment adoption, especially in developing markets, has also led to a surge in cyber threats. Phishing scams, ransomware attacks, man-in-the-middle (MITM) intrusions, and API vulnerabilities have become common ways for attackers to exploit weaknesses in fintech systems.
Security testing ensures that vulnerabilities are detected early and fixed before hackers can exploit them. It evaluates the strength of authentication mechanisms, encryption protocols, and data handling methods to ensure that financial transactions remain secure and tamper-proof.
Key Goals of Security Testing in Financial Applications
Security testing goes beyond checking for bugs ,it validates whether an application can withstand real-world attacks. Its main objectives include:
Types of Security Testing Used in Financial Systems
A comprehensive security testing strategy includes multiple layers of assessment. Here are the most common types used in the BFSI sector:
1. Penetration Testing (Pen Testing)
Penetration testing simulates real-world attacks to evaluate how well a system can resist unauthorized access. Ethical hackers attempt to exploit vulnerabilities in payment gateways, APIs, and authentication systems ,helping developers identify and fix security loopholes before they are exploited in the wild.
2. Vulnerability Assessment
This involves scanning applications, servers, and networks to detect known vulnerabilities and misconfigurations. It’s often performed alongside penetration testing for a holistic view of system security.
3. API Security Testing
Financial applications heavily depend on APIs to exchange data between services. Testing ensures APIs have proper authentication, authorization, and encryption mechanisms, preventing unauthorized access and data leaks.
4. Authentication & Authorization Testing
This checks the robustness of login mechanisms, password policies, session management, and role-based access controls ,ensuring only authorized users can initiate transactions or access financial data.
5. Data Encryption Testing
Security testing verifies whether encryption algorithms are correctly implemented for data at rest and in transit, protecting sensitive financial data from being intercepted or exposed.
6. Compliance & Regulatory Testing
Financial systems must adhere to strict compliance frameworks such as SOX, PCI DSS, and PSD2. Security testing validates that all processes and data management systems meet these requirements.
Common Security Threats in Financial Transactions
Before understanding how testing helps, it’s essential to recognize the typical threats that plague financial applications:
Without proper testing, even a single unpatched vulnerability can compromise thousands of transactions.
How Security Testing Protects Financial Transactions
Security testing provides multi-layered protection across the transaction lifecycle ,from login to fund transfer. Here’s how:
1. Strengthens Authentication Systems
Testing verifies whether multi-factor authentication (MFA), biometric login, and token-based systems are correctly implemented and resistant to brute-force attacks.
2. Ensures Secure Data Transmission
Tests ensure that financial data is transmitted securely using encryption protocols like TLS 1.3, preventing eavesdropping or interception.
3. Validates API Security
Security testing identifies vulnerabilities in APIs connecting mobile apps, banking systems, and payment gateways ,preventing unauthorized access or transaction tampering.
4. Prevents Fraudulent Activities
Through continuous monitoring and real-time testing, systems can detect unusual patterns or suspicious activities ,enabling early fraud detection.
5. Supports Compliance Readiness
By integrating compliance testing into the CI/CD pipeline, organizations can ensure every deployment aligns with the latest data protection laws.
Integrating Security Testing into the Development Lifecycle
In traditional systems, testing occurs after development. However, with DevSecOps and shift-left testing, security is embedded from the early stages of the software lifecycle.
By integrating automated security testing tools and real device testing platforms like HeadSpin, fintech organizations can:
This proactive approach ensures that every code change is tested for security compliance before it reaches production ,significantly reducing risks.
Benefits of Continuous Security Testing for FinTech and Banking
Conclusion
In today’s interconnected financial ecosystem, trust is built on security. Every transaction, whether a small digital wallet payment or a high-value investment transfer, must be protected by robust, continuously tested security frameworks.
Security testing is not just a technical necessity ,it’s a strategic safeguard for the financial industry. By adopting comprehensive, automated, and real-device-based testing solutions, organizations can ensure that every transaction remains secure, compliant, and resilient against emerging threats.
The future of finance depends on security ,and security depends on rigorous, continuous testing.
Sign in with your Facebook account or email.